According to the product specialist

Pros
The lens is made from a single piece and is completely frameless, giving you the best possible view.
Extremely lightweight glasses, you barely notice you're wearing them.
The Prizm lens ensures optimal colour contrast, giving you an even better view ahead with these on.
The Sutro Lite has a semi-rimless frame for a greater field of view.
The frame is made of O-Matter material, which provides durability and low weight.
The Unobtainium in the nose pads and legs ensures a secure fit.
The Prizm Road lens can be used when cycling in sunny daylight and in the shade.
The Prizm Road lens creates a contrast-enhancing effect, making it easier to distinguish colours.
The wider lens of the Radar EV provides a better and larger field of view.
The new 'surge ports' preserve the cool airflow.
The frame is lightweight and durable as it is made from Oakley's own O-Matter.
Thanks to its light transmittance of only 20%, the Prizm Road lens is suitable for sunny days.
Smaller version of the Sutro model, with the same versatile and cool look.
The frame is made of O-Matter, which makes the glasses both lightweight and durable.
Thanks to the Unobtainium nosepiece, the Sutro S remains well and securely in place.
The narrow arms allow you to combine these glasses with helmets and caps.
The Prizm Road lens is suitable for both sunny daylight and cycling in the shade.
Cons
The lens can't be swapped.
While the Prizm Road lens is Oakley's all-round lens, it may be too dark for use in the forest.
Changing the lenses takes some practice and may require some time the first few times.
Although the Prizm Road lens is Oakley's all-round model, at times it may be too dark to be used in the woods.
